Bio & background

Finnish-born commercial director Mikko Lehtinen has directed hundreds of spots across more than 50 countries and all seven continents. Founder of Sauna International, he is repped exclusively in the U.S. by The Board of Directors (2025) and in Canada by Sparks Productions, with additional roster presence via AgentZoo. He broke through with Fragile Childhood’s PSA “Monsters” (Havas Finland), which earned a Cannes Gold Lion after years of shortlists, drew millions of views, and received Golden Drum cinematography recognition. Award records also include a 2012 One Show Merit for Bank Forum Commerzbank Group’s “German Style” (Ogilvy Ukraine), plus Clio, D&AD, Epic, and multiple British Arrows credits, and Cancer Society of Finland’s anti-smoking film “Baby Love.” Roster and trade work spans Tori’s “Keep on Movin'” (remote-controlled and wire-rigged in-camera gags), McDonald’s “Action Heroes,” Coca-Cola, Finnair “Shortcut to Europe,” Lidl, Milka, Merrell “Shoes That Breathe,” Regaine “Vet,” Range Rover, and Volkswagen. Materials emphasize performance direction, rhythm and timing, an animator’s eye for art direction and casting, slow-motion used with comedy, and hands-on in-camera solutions over hollow spectacle.
